THEATRE PROGRAMMES

Repertory Theatre: “Back to Methuselah” and “The Dark Lady of the Sonnets.” Mayfair: “Elizabeth is Queen.” Avon and St James’: “The Planter’s Wife.” State: “Tonight We Sing.” Regent, Tivoli, and Plaza: “A Queen is Crowned.” Majestic: “The House of Wax.” Crystal Palace: “I’d Climb the Highest Mountain.” Grand: “There is Another Sun.” Liberty: “I Dream of Jeanie.” Metro: “Diplomatic Courier” and “The Magnet. Century: “Fanny By Gaslight.” Rex: “KiSs Tomorrow Good-bye.”
